Trail Overview
This trail is an offshoot of Bogue Road Spur 2, featuring a sandy double-track path with a mix of obstacles, including loose sand, mud pits, and tight tree corridors. The trail begins with loose-packed sand, creating a fun driving experience, while scattered mud pits vary in size and depth depending on recent rainfall. The tree corridors are extremely narrow, posing a high risk of pinstriping for larger vehicles. At the end of the trail, an exceptionally tight water crossing may be too narrow for full-size vehicles to pass through without significant pinstriping or scratches.

Difficulty
The trail begins with very loose sand, which can become quite deep at times, posing a challenge for some vehicles. Additionally, several mud holes are scattered throughout the trail, which can be particularly difficult to navigate after heavy rainfall.
